A MESSAGE FROM THE CHURCHES CONSERVATION TRUST

Archaeological Surveying training opportunity at St George's Church, Portland, Dorset

We have just been granted HLF funding to aid our conservation and archaeological surveying project at St George’s Church on Portland Island. We are hoping to incorporate a training element to the archaeological recording and surveying and have been working with Wessex Archaeology to develop a programme using the most recent surveying and laser-scanning technology.

I am writing to you to ask if any of your members would like to be included in this training, which is due to take place from now through to early next year. We will be working with university students as well, but I wanted to give local archaeological societies to opportunity to take part in the exciting project and to gain some invaluable training and experience in archaeological recording and surveying techniques.

If you’d like more details please feel free to contact me.
